AccueilFAQRechercherS'enregistrerConnexion
 

Un drole de bug

Voir le sujet précédent Voir le sujet suivant Aller en bas 
AuteurMessage
Maxs
Timide
Timide


Sexe:Masculin
Age : 19
Inscrit le : 17 Déc 2006
Messages : 63
Programme utilisé (Gm/RmXp/...) : Game Maker 7.0 pro - CodeBlocks - Opera :p
Etudes : Electroniques
Loisirs : Programmer

MessageSujet: Un drole de bug   Sam 3 Mai - 13:29

Bonjours a tous ! ^^

Bon voila j'utilise game maker 7 pro.

J'ai créer un objet menu :
ev10 :

m=0;

ev100 :

if (keyboard_check_pressed(vk_enter))
{
switch (m)
{
case 0: m=1; instance_deactivate_all(1); break;
case 1: m=0; instance_activate_all(); break;
}
}

ev50 :

if (m)
{
draw_sprite(sprite_index,0,view_xview,view_yview+32);
}

Vous serez j'éspère tous d'accord pour dire qu'il n'y a pas de bugs. :P

Je lance le jeu et BAF ! une erreur O.O il ne connait pas la variable m ...

J'ai transformer l'évenement create en game start, et la ça fonctionne, mais j'aimerai quand meme bien savoir pourquoi avec l'event create ça va pas ...

Donc voila, si quelqu'un a une solution a ce mystèrieux problème ça serait bien merci. :)

EDIT :

En fait ce bug ne se produit que lorsque je crée cet objet a aprtir d'un event create.

( je vais essayé de refaire complètement l'objet pour voir ...)

EDIT 2 :

J'ai recréer un autre objet qui fait la meme chose, je le crée a partir du create d'un objet, lorsque je met l'objet créer en persistant, ça me fait le bug, et quand je met pas en persistant, l'objet ne se crée meme pas ... la y'a un fameux problème :S
Revenir en haut Aller en bas
Wargamer
Discret
Discret


Sexe:Masculin
Inscrit le : 08 Mar 2008
Messages : 189

MessageSujet: Re: Un drole de bug   Sam 3 Mai - 15:10

c'est quoi le message d'erreur? :p
Revenir en haut Aller en bas
Rayman3640
Habitué
Habitué


Sexe:Masculin
Age : 14
Inscrit le : 29 Avr 2008
Messages : 291
Programme utilisé (Gm/RmXp/...) : GM7 Pro/VC++(j'apprends le C)/
Etudes : Collégien
Loisirs : Informatique, tennis, lecture, écriture, jeux vidéo, handball

MessageSujet: Re: Un drole de bug   Sam 3 Mai - 15:14

Maxs a écrit:

Je lance le jeu et BAF ! une erreur O.O il ne connait pas la variable m ...


Quand le jeu ne connaît pas une variable, il affiche un truc dans le genre "unknown variable m" puis parfois si tu utilises des if, "cannot compare atgument".
_________________

Supra-Quest, un jeu vidéo concentrant une aventure épique, un monde presque sans limites à découvrir et un système de combat novateur !
N'oubliez pas de visiter le SQ-Devblog, le blog de développement du jeu !
Revenir en haut Aller en bas
Wargamer
Discret
Discret


Sexe:Masculin
Inscrit le : 08 Mar 2008
Messages : 189

MessageSujet: Re: Un drole de bug   Sam 3 Mai - 15:24

c'est ptet le draw qui veux dessiner M avant qu'elle sois déclarer lol
Revenir en haut Aller en bas
Maxs
Timide
Timide


Sexe:Masculin
Age : 19
Inscrit le : 17 Déc 2006
Messages : 63
Programme utilisé (Gm/RmXp/...) : Game Maker 7.0 pro - CodeBlocks - Opera :p
Etudes : Electroniques
Loisirs : Programmer

MessageSujet: Re: Un drole de bug   Sam 3 Mai - 15:41

En fait j'ai fait quelques tests, et je pense que le problème vien du fait que les objets soit persistants ou non, j'ai un bug encore plus énorme, depuis que j'ai commencé mon jeu mon personnage principal est persistant ( logique ) mais pour le moment j'ai qu'une seule room donc ça sert pas a grand chose j'ai décocher la case persistant et PAF mon jeu plante au démarrage, l'écran est tout noir, et je sais meme pas le fermer ...

Faudrai que je reprenne game maker 6, j'avais moin de problème -_-° mais maintenant que j'ai vista ça va etre dur ... :'(
Revenir en haut Aller en bas

Un drole de bug

Voir le sujet précédent Voir le sujet suivant Revenir en haut 
Page 1 sur 1

Permission de ce forum:Vous ne pouvez pas répondre aux sujets dans ce forum
Game Maker Zone :: Zone : Game Maker :: Game Maker - Problèmes :: GM - Problèmes : Niveau Expert-